Engine Performance and Mechanical Specifications

Under the hood, the GLE 450 features a turbocharged 3.0L inline-6 paired with a 48V mild hybrid system. This configuration delivers 362 horsepower and 369 lb-ft of torque, accelerating 0-60 mph in 5.3 seconds. According to SAE International certification standards:

  • Outpaces Audi Q7 45 (5.5 seconds)
  • Trails BMW X5 xDrive40i (5.0 seconds)
    Fuel efficiency sits at 20 city/25 highway/22 combined MPG – identical to segment averages. The standard 4MATIC all-wheel drive system and 9-speed automatic transmission provide confident traction, though I observed the steering lacks the X5's razor-sharp feedback during aggressive maneuvers.

Key powertrain notes:

  1. EQ Boost hybrid enables silent low-speed operation
  2. Four engine options available (base GLE 350 starts at 255 hp)
  3. AMG 53/63 trims available for performance seekers

Interior Comfort and Technology Analysis

Stepping inside reveals Mercedes' mastery of cabin ambiance. The optional AMG Line package ($3,000) adds Nappa leather sport seats and brushed aluminum accents, though I recommend the Espresso Brown/Black leather combo for better value. Standard features include:

  • Heated 12-way power front seats
  • Dual 12.3" displays (gauge cluster + infotainment)
  • 64-color ambient lighting with responsive mood settings

MBUX infotainment stands above rivals based on usability testing. Voice commands ("Hey Mercedes") work flawlessly while driving – a critical safety advantage for parents. The Burmester® sound system (Premium Package) and acoustic glass create a library-quiet cabin, measuring 4dB quieter than the X5 at 70mph in third-party tests.

Second-row space deserves special mention:

HeadroomLegroomCargo (seats up)
GLE 45039.9"40.9"33.3 cu ft
Audi Q738.8"38.8"30.2 cu ft
BMW X539.1"37.4"33.9 cu ft

Driving Experience and Real-World Usability

The optional AIRMATIC suspension ($1,700) transforms the driving dynamic. During simulated school-run scenarios:

  • Speed bumps absorbed with minimal cabin disturbance
  • Highway expansion joints feel like minor textures
  • Sport mode firms dampers for twisty-road confidence

Three critical observations from test footage:

  1. Standard adaptive high beam assist outperforms BMW's implementation on rural roads
  2. Lane-change assist (Driving Assistance Package) works intuitively but requires supervision
  3. Third-row option reduces cargo space to 12 cu ft – insufficient for serious family use

Braking performance impressed me most, with 60-0 mph stops averaging 112 feet – 3 feet shorter than the Q7 in identical conditions. The mild hybrid system provides seamless start-stop functionality, though I noticed slight hesitation during sudden acceleration demands.

Pricing Breakdown and Competitive Positioning

The GLE 450's $64,500 base price positions it strategically:

  • Audi Q7 55: $62,295 (less powerful V6)
  • BMW X5 xDrive40i: $63,895 (sharper handling)
  • Mercedes GLE 350: $57,200 (entry 4-cylinder)

Beware the options trap: Our analyzed model ballooned to $82k with:

  • Night Package ($900)
  • 22" AMG wheels ($1,300)
  • Premium Package ($3,500)
  • Acoustic Comfort Glass ($850)

Value verdict: Skip the Nappa leather ($3k) and oversized wheels – prioritize the AIRMATIC suspension and Driver Assistance Package.

Final Verdict: Who Should Choose the GLE 450?

The Mercedes GLE 450 excels for families prioritizing cabin serenity and second-row space over sporty handling. Its MBUX interface and superior noise insulation create a stress-reducing environment that Audi and BMW can't match at this price point. However, performance enthusiasts will prefer the X5, while tech-minimalists might find the Q7's interface less overwhelming.
